Step-by-Step LinkedIn Registration Guide

Step 1: Open LinkedIn’s registration page using MostLogin

In your configured browser profile, visit LinkedIn’s official website , click “Register now” or “Join now,” and enter the signup page.

 

LinkedIn homepage

 

Step 2: Enter your email and password

Use an email address that has never been registered on LinkedIn. Set a password and click “Agree & Join.”

 

Enter LinkedIn email and password

 

Step 3: Enter your name

Fill in your real name (consistent with your ID). Click “Continue.”

 

Fill in full legal name

 

Step 4: Verify your phone number

Enter a phone number that has not been used on LinkedIn before. Receive and input the verification code.

 

Verify phone number

 

Step 5: Complete basic information

Follow the prompts to fill in your region, job status, and career preferences.

 

Complete personal info

 

Reaching this page means your registration is complete.

Step 6: Improve your profile

Upload a profile photo and complete your work experience, skills, and education. Ensure every account has unique and authentic information.
